| Match #2 - WWE Intercontinental Championship (SMDN) | |||
| Rey Myterio Challenger |
def. | Chris Jericho Champion |
via Pinfall (15:42) |
| Notes: -TITLE CHANGE- Another clinic put on by these two. The replay montage at the end of the match was great. Rey tried a baseball slide that Jericho countered by swinging Rey like a baseball bat into the security wall. I have to give Rey credit too. He did this double-springboard thing that was awesome. At the end Jericho tore off Rey's mask, only to find out that Rey had another one on underneath. The surprise let Rey connect with the 619 and it was over. Sweet match. | |||

| Match #4 - WWE Unified Tag Team Championship - Triple Threat Match (INTER) | |||
| Edge & Chris Jericho (SMDN) Challengers |
def. | Carlito & Primo Colon (RAW) Champions "The Legacy" (RAW) (Ted DiBiase & Cody Rhodes) Challengers |
via Pinfall (9:39) |
| Notes: -TITLE CHANGE- Teddy Long made this a Triple Threat match just before, since Vince McMahon met with him in the prior segment, saying Teddy was still on probation. Earlier in the night Edge complained to Teddy about not being on the card and Jericho complained to Teddy about the way he lost to Mysterio. So Teddy threw in Edge & Jericho. The other two teams were not pleased, and for most of the match they fought and ignored the interlopers. Edge tagged in briefly, but missed a spear and was tagged out. Edge tagged himself in and Carlito was surprised when the referee didn't count his pin on Rhodes. He learned a bit too late that Edge was the legal man and turned around into a spear. Edge pinned Carlito and Jericho was never even in the match. Which was fine because he was probably spent after his prior bout. | |||

| Match #6 - World Heavyweight Championship (SMDN) | |||
| Jeff Hardy Challenger |
def. | CM Punk Champion |
via DQ (14:53) |
| Notes: OK match for the most part. Jeff actually got a three count in at 12:45 and the bell even rang, but the referee immediately saw Punk's foot under the bottom rope and waved off the finish. Jeff was upset and went after Punk's eye, the same one he had damaged earlier in the match. The referee had to check the eye and after doing so, Punk kicked him in the back, causing the DQ. Was it intentional or not...that was the question. It was clear in Hardy's eyes, as he jumped Punk on the entryway and fought with him back in the ring until more referees intervened. | |||

| Match #8 - WWE World Heavyweight Championship - Three Stages of Hell Match (RAW) | |||
| Randy Orton Champion |
def. | Triple H Challenger |
via 2-1 (21:22) |
| Notes: Randy Orton won the first stage (traditional match) by DQ at 4:51 when Triple H repeatedly beat Orton with a chair. That beating allowed Triple H to immediately win the second stage (falls count anywhere) via pinfall after a Pedigree outside the ring at 5:18. The third stage was a stretcher match, which Orton won with the help of Legacy. They attacked and prevented Triple H from pushing the stretcher past the line. Triple H had a sledge hidden under a panel of steel grating up on the stage, and used it on Legacy, but Randy hit him with the steel panel and Trips fell right on the stretcher. Randy had to push it only a few feet to win. | |||
